首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在尾风CSS中使用彩色方框阴影来实现NProgress发光效果?

尾风CSS是一种轻量级的CSS库,它提供了一些实用的样式效果和组件,包括了彩色方框阴影效果和NProgress发光效果。

彩色方框阴影是一种常见的页面装饰效果,它可以为元素添加一个带有颜色的阴影边框。在尾风CSS中,可以使用以下代码来实现彩色方框阴影:

代码语言:txt
复制
.box-shadow {
  box-shadow: 0 0 10px #ff0000;
}

上述代码中,box-shadow属性用于添加阴影效果,其中第一个参数0表示阴影水平偏移量,第二个参数0表示阴影垂直偏移量,第三个参数10px表示阴影模糊半径,最后一个参数#ff0000表示阴影颜色,这里使用红色。

NProgress发光效果是一种进度条效果,它会在页面加载或操作过程中显示一个渐变的光晕效果。在尾风CSS中,可以使用以下代码来实现NProgress发光效果:

代码语言:txt
复制
.nprogress {
  background-image: linear-gradient(to right, #ff0000, #ffff00, #00ff00);
  animation: nprogress 2s infinite linear;
}

@keyframes nprogress {
  0% {
    background-position: 0% 50%;
  }
  100% {
    background-position: 100% 50%;
  }
}

上述代码中,.nprogress类用于添加NProgress发光效果,background-image属性使用linear-gradient函数创建一个渐变背景色,其中to right表示渐变方向从左到右,#ff0000#ffff00#00ff00为渐变色值。animation属性用于添加动画效果,nprogress为动画名称,2s表示动画持续时间为2秒,infinite表示动画无限循环,linear表示线性动画。

这里推荐使用腾讯云的CDN加速产品,CDN是一种内容分发网络服务,它可以将静态资源缓存到全球分布的节点,加速资源的访问速度。腾讯云的CDN产品可以有效提升网页加载速度和用户体验,适用于各种网站和应用场景。

更多关于腾讯云CDN的信息和产品介绍,可以参考腾讯云官网的CDN产品页面

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Vue3+TS的项目中使用NProgress进度条

NProgress 是一个轻量级的进度条组件,它的原理非常简单,就是页面启动的时候,构建一个方法,创建一个 div,用 fixed 定位,把这个 div 定位在页面最顶部。相信很多小伙伴都知道,一个页面或者一个接口的进度计算是非常复杂的,即便能够被计算出来,那么消耗的性能也是非常大的,得不偿失,这个时候虚拟进度条的作用就显现出来了。开始进入处理方法的时候,就启动 loading 的效果,一旦捕获到这个方法结束,就去释放它,为了防止过程比较生硬,释放后也会有一个进度条缓慢加载到 100%的过程。很多项目上都在使用,最近在重构 Vue3 的版本,所以打算直接把它引用在新的项目上。

02

【分享干货】做网页设计的常用css代码大全

color : #999999; /*文字颜色*/ font-family : 宋体,sans-serif; /*文字字体*/ font-size : 9pt; /*文字大小*/ font-style:itelic; /*文字斜体*/ font-variant:small-caps; /*小字体*/ letter-spacing : 1pt; /*字间距离*/ line-height : 200%; /*设置行高*/ font-weight:bold; /*文字粗体*/ vertical-align:sub; /*下标字*/ vertical-align:super; /*上标字*/ text-decoration:line-through; /*加删除线*/ text-decoration: overline; /*加顶线*/ text-decoration:underline; /*加下划线*/ text-decoration:none; /*删除链接下划线*/ text-transform : capitalize; /*首字大写*/ text-transform : uppercase; /*英文大写*/ text-transform : lowercase; /*英文小写*/ text-align:right; /*文字右对齐*/  text-align:left; /*文字左对齐*/ text-align:center; /*文字居中对齐*/ text-align:justify; /*文字分散对齐*/ vertical-align属性 vertical-align:top; /*垂直向上对齐*/ vertical-align:bottom; /*垂直向下对齐*/ vertical-align:middle; /*垂直居中对齐*/ vertical-align:text-top; /*文字垂直向上对齐*/ vertical-align:text-bottom; /*文字垂直向下对齐*/ 二、CSS边框空白 padding-top:10px; /*上边框留空白*/ padding-right:10px; /*右边框留空白*/ padding-bottom:10px; /*下边框留空白*/ padding-left:10px; /*左边框留空白 三、CSS符号属性 list-style-type:none; /*不编号*/ list-style-type:decimal; /*阿拉伯数字*/ list-style-type:lower-roman; /*小写罗马数字*/ list-style-type:upper-roman; /*大写罗马数字*/ list-style-type:lower-alpha; /*小写英文字母*/ list-style-type:upper-alpha; /*大写英文字母*/ list-style-type:disc; /*实心圆形符号*/ list-style-type:circle; /*空心圆形符号*/ list-style-type:square; /*实心方形符号*/ list-style-image:url(/dot.gif); /*图片式符号*/ list-style-position: outside; /*凸排*/ list-style-position:inside; /*缩进*/ 四、CSS背景样式 background-color:#F5E2EC; /*背景颜色*/  background:transparent; /*透视背景*/ background-image : url(/image/bg.gif); /*背景图片*/ background-attachment : fixed; /*浮水印固定背景*/ background-repeat : repeat; /*重复排列-网页默认*/ background-repeat : no-repeat; /*不重复排列*/ background-repeat : repeat-x; /*在x轴重复排列*/ background-repeat : repeat-y; /*在y轴重复排列*/ 指定背景位置 background-position : 90% 90%; /*背景图片x与y轴的位置*/ background-position : top; /*向上对齐*/ background-position : buttom; /*向下对齐*/ background-position : left; /*向左对齐*/ background-position : right; /*向右对齐*/ background-position : center; /*居中对齐*/ 五、CSS连接属性 a /*所有超链接*/

01
领券